basic_usage.rs1use faceit::HttpClient;
2
3#[tokio::main]
4async fn main() -> Result<(), faceit::error::Error> {
5 let client = HttpClient::new();
7
8 println!("Fetching player by ID...");
15 match client.get_player("player-id-here").await {
16 Ok(player) => {
17 println!("Player: {}", player.nickname);
18 if let Some(country) = player.country {
19 println!("Country: {}", country);
20 }
21 }
22 Err(e) => eprintln!("Error fetching player: {}", e),
23 }
24
25 println!("\nFetching player from lookup...");
27 match client
28 .get_player_from_lookup(Some("player_nickname"), Some("cs2"), None)
29 .await
30 {
31 Ok(player) => {
32 println!("Player: {}", player.nickname);
33 }
34 Err(e) => eprintln!("Error fetching player: {}", e),
35 }
36
37 println!("\nFetching player stats...");
39 match client.get_player_stats("player-id-here", "cs2").await {
40 Ok(stats) => {
41 println!("Player ID: {}", stats.player_id);
42 println!("Game ID: {}", stats.game_id);
43 }
44 Err(e) => eprintln!("Error fetching stats: {}", e),
45 }
46
47 println!("\nFetching player match history...");
49 match client
50 .get_player_history("player-id-here", "cs2", None, None, Some(0), Some(20))
51 .await
52 {
53 Ok(history) => {
54 println!("Found {} matches", history.items.len());
55 if let Some(first_match) = history.items.first() {
56 println!("Most recent match: {}", first_match.match_id);
57 }
58 }
59 Err(e) => eprintln!("Error fetching history: {}", e),
60 }
61
62 println!("\nFetching match details...");
64 match client.get_match("match-id-here").await {
65 Ok(match_details) => {
66 println!("Match ID: {}", match_details.match_id);
67 println!("Game: {}", match_details.game);
68 println!("Status: {}", match_details.status);
69 }
70 Err(e) => eprintln!("Error fetching match: {}", e),
71 }
72
73 println!("\nFetching match stats...");
75 match client.get_match_stats("match-id-here").await {
76 Ok(stats) => {
77 println!("Rounds: {}", stats.rounds.len());
78 }
79 Err(e) => eprintln!("Error fetching match stats: {}", e),
80 }
81
82 println!("\nSearching for players...");
84 match client
85 .search_players("player_name", Some("cs2"), None, Some(0), Some(20))
86 .await
87 {
88 Ok(results) => {
89 println!("Found {} players", results.items.len());
90 for player in results.items.iter().take(5) {
91 println!(" - {} ({})", player.nickname, player.player_id);
92 }
93 }
94 Err(e) => eprintln!("Error searching players: {}", e),
95 }
96
97 println!("\nFetching all games...");
99 match client.get_all_games(Some(0), Some(20)).await {
100 Ok(games) => {
101 println!("Found {} games", games.items.len());
102 for game in games.items.iter().take(5) {
103 println!(" - {} ({})", game.long_label, game.game_id);
104 }
105 }
106 Err(e) => eprintln!("Error fetching games: {}", e),
107 }
108
109 println!("\nFetching hub details...");
111 match client.get_hub("hub-id-here", None).await {
112 Ok(hub) => {
113 println!("Hub: {}", hub.name);
114 println!("Game: {}", hub.game_id);
115 }
116 Err(e) => eprintln!("Error fetching hub: {}", e),
117 }
118
119 println!("\nFetching global ranking...");
121 match client
122 .get_global_ranking("cs2", "EU", None, Some(0), Some(20))
123 .await
124 {
125 Ok(ranking) => {
126 println!("Found {} players in ranking", ranking.items.len());
127 for entry in ranking.items.iter().take(5) {
128 println!(
129 " {}: {} - ELO: {}",
130 entry.position, entry.nickname, entry.faceit_elo
131 );
132 }
133 }
134 Err(e) => eprintln!("Error fetching ranking: {}", e),
135 }
136
137 println!("\nCreating client with builder...");
139 let _custom_client = HttpClient::builder()
140 .api_key("your-api-key-or-access-token-here")
141 .timeout(std::time::Duration::from_secs(60))
142 .build()?;
143
144 println!("Client created with custom configuration");
145
146 Ok(())
147}
